Output 6f3fcb3a521eb50ab9c12bc71d89d0894f2df4ed31ff61a0aec6ca9fa3bdb9f8:0

value
591663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c86e374b0c852870f8149da2adbfab4c54c41c3 OP_EQUAL
address
32qFd4c3G2F3u3KVirqfxUe1vJkRy2Fvyh
transaction
6f3fcb3a521eb50ab9c12bc71d89d0894f2df4ed31ff61a0aec6ca9fa3bdb9f8
confirmations
379856
spent
true